Re: I can't view LUNs in HP EVA3000
There is no 3.5.x listing for the EVA3000/5000 in SPOCK, but there IS a 3.5.x listing for the EVA 4/6/8k.
There msy be a different custom host mode type that you need to use for 3.5.x and/or may need to upgrade your Command View and/or VCS.
Keep in mind that ESX 3.5.x is relatively new as compared to the EVA 3000.

Re: I can't view LUNs in HP EVA3000
it seems that only Active/Active EVA 3000/5000 firmware (V.4.100) will be supported with the ESX 3.5x

Re: I can't view LUNs in HP EVA3000
No. You will need at the very minimum, CV 6.0.2. You do not need to upgrade your license to use 6.x. You would need to obtain the software though somehow.
You would also need to obtain the 4.100 VCS and upgrade your WIndows hosts to MPIO Full Featured DSM for VCS 4.x

Re: I can't view LUNs in HP EVA3000
I have proved first way. I downgraded vmware to 3.0 version. In this version I can view the LUNs presented through Commnad View EVA correctly.
Now I´m thinking if the risk of the second way (upgrade VCS firmware and Commnad View EVA) is worth.

Re: I can't view LUNs in HP EVA3000
This script was used for "persistent target binding" in VMware ESX V2.5.
V3.x does implicit "persistent LUN binding".
However, if a (re)scan does not find any storage - NO FORM of persistent binding will help.
ESX V3.5 comes with new device drivers and did require a new certification, but I am surprised that it did not even detect the EVA controller LUNs at LUN address 0...
